JISSP Scholarships Details
The scholarships span central and state government programs as well as AICTE and institute-specific awards. Below is a summary table with the most verifiable scholarships, eligibility, and benefits. Final award confirmation depends on document verification and available quotas.
| Scholarship | Details |
| State Government Scholarships | Includes Nabanna Scholarship, Swami Vivekananda Merit-Cum-Means (SVMCM), OASIS (SC/ST/OBC), Kanyashree Prakalpa, and other WB government scholarships. |
| AICTE Scholarships | Includes AICTE YASHASVI, AICTE SWANATH, AICTE PRAGATI (for girls), AICTE SAKSHAM (for differently-abled), and other AICTE programs. |
| Central Government Scholarships | Available via the National Scholarship Portal (NSP) or other central government schemes. |
| Private / Trust-Based Scholarships | Includes scholarships from trusts, foundations, or corporate bodies as applicable to eligible students. |
